The objectives of this role are:

- Assist with HSE management plan actions involving employee awareness of risks and to reduce, avoid and protect employees from hazards in the workplace, including occupational illness or disease.
- Assists in the implementation of programs to maintain and improve the general health and safety of all employees

This role will be involved with:

- Provide HSE advice, guidance, assistance and support to the Assignment.
- Facilitate consultative processes to improve communication and participation in HSEQ, promote the Health and Well-being of personnel and take the actions required to reduce our environment footprint
- Coach or otherwise develop the competencies of personnel to contribute to workplace and community HSEQ with a particular focus on
- Confined spaces, workplace inspections, Health and Wellbeing, Environmental impacts and aspects, Material storage handing and use (including hazardous chemicals).
- Facilitate the timely response to HSE issues and incidents, including the recording, reporting and analyses of HSEQ leading and lagging performance metrics.

**Qualifications**:
Bachelor's degree in Occupational Health and Safety, Environmental Science, or a related field.
